[ S.L.409.11 HOLIDAY PREMISES 1 SUBSIDIARY LEGISLATION 409.11 HOLIDAY PREMISES REGULATIONS * 31st May, 2002 LEGAL NOTICE 131 of 2002, as amended by Legal Notices 86 of 2005 and 221 of 2023. 1. The title of these regulations is the Holiday Premises Regulations. Citation. 2.

(1)requires - Interpretation. In these regulations, unless the context otherwise "Act" means the Malta Travel and Tourism Services Act; Cap. 409. "farmhouse" means a holiday premises which is constructed and finished to represent a typical Maltese farmhouse, located in an area compatible with a farmhouse environment; "holiday premises" has the same meaning as assigned to it in the Act and shall include apartments, studios, villas, maisonettes, townhouses and terraced houses and other accommodation as the Authority may approve to fall within the said category.
(2)Words and expressions used in these regulations which are also used in the Act shall, unless the context otherwise requires, have the same meaning as in the Act.
  1. Holiday premises shall be classified, prior to being licensed, according to the criteria established according to the Second Schedule with regard to holiday premises and according to the Third Schedule with regard to farmhouses. Classification.
  2. Holiday premises shall be classified by the Authority in three grades, "Standard" "Comfort" and "Superior" with "Standard" denoting the lowest grade and "Superior" denoting the highest grade. Classification of holiday premises. 5.
(1)The holiday premises category shall include: I. apartments (to be classified as "Standard" "Comfort and "Superior"); II. studios (to be classified as "Standard" and "Comfort); III. villas (to be classified as "Comfort"); IV. villas with exclusive swimming pool within premises (to be classified as "Superior").
(2)The classification grades of these categories shall also apply to similar accommodation properties such as townhouses, maisonettes and terraced houses, as the Authority may deem appropriate. *These regulations have been repealed by Legal Notice 92 of
  1. Properties falling within the holiday premises category. 2 [ S.L.409.11 HOLIDAY PREMISES Classification of farmhouses.
  2. Farmhouses shall be classified by the Authority in two grades, either a "comfort" grade or a "superior" grade with "comfort" denoting the lower grade and "superior" denoting the higher grade. Compliance to classification standards.

Persons licensed by the Authority to operate holiday premises shall ensure that their properties comply with the standard requirements as shown in the Second Schedule, with regard to holiday premises and in the Third Schedule with regards to farmhouses. 7A. The Authority and, or any other Authority appointed to carry out the duties contained in these regulations shall, on receiving a request, communicate all the data in relation to the holiday premises to the Local Council where the holiday premises are situated, for the purpose of enforcement of these regulations and to ensure the best upkeep and sanitary conditions of the locality where the holiday premises are situated. Communication of data by the Authority. Added by: L.N. 221 of
  4. Alternative services and amenities. 8.
(1)Notwithstanding any service and amenity requirement contained in these regulations, the Authority may, in exceptional circumstances, for the purpose of classification of any holiday premises, accept alternative services and amenities instead of those set out in these regulations as the Authority may deem appropriate.
(2)The Authority may, at any time, after giving reasonable notice, withdraw the concession of accepting alternative amenities or services in lieu of amenities and services specified in the classification regulations, as referred to in subregulation
(1). Offences and penalties. 9. Any person who fails to comply with any of the provisions of these regulations shall be guilty of an offence, and shall be liable to the fines and penalties as indicated in articles 43 and 45 of the Act. Saving. 10. Any licence issued under the Guesthouses and Holiday Furnished Premises Regulations, 1994, repealed by these regulations, and which is in force immediately before such repeal, shall, subject to compliance with the provisions of the Act and to the regulations made thereunder, continue to be in force thereafter as if it were a licence granted under the Act and the regulations made thereunder.
